There’s no doubt that certain makeup techniques – such as winged liner or intricate eyeshadow looks – are tricky to master, despite the number of best eyeliners and TikTok tricks promising easy application. But these looks can be even more difficult for those with motor disabilities or visual impairments.
So we’re super excited about the launch of these smart new beauty tools, which make it easy for everyone to achieve flawless flicks every time. Kohl Kreatives’ Quickies Stickies, £9.99 here, are adhesive stencils that are placed on the eyelid and mark out the perfect makeup placement.
Simply attach the stickie, apply a powder or cream eyeshadow, or eyeliner, over the top (brand founder Trish Daswaney recommends using a dabbing motion rather than swiping), then peel off to reveal a precise shape. Each pack contains four sheets, and each sheet holds six pairs of stickers in a range of wing, heart and star shapes – they’re reusable too, if you peel them off carefully.The pack also comes with a tactile QR code which links to a “how to” video and audio guide, and the outer packaging is made from paper recycled from rice waste.
Kohl Kreatives also sells a selection of inclusive makeup brushes, starting from £8.99, with design features that make it simple for anyone to use, such as braille labelling, fully flexible brush heads and easy-to-grip handles.They’re perfect for creating some of 2022’s hottest makeup trends, or perhaps a Euphoria-inspired look. Proceeds from Kohl Kreatives' brush sales also go towards Kohl Kares, the brand's charity empowering people through the power of makeup.
